The ‘IMOCA’ is Sponsored and Designed by Hugo Boss

The 60-foot ‘IMOCA’ is one of the world's fastest and most stylish racing yachts. The IMOCA is built from a composite material to ensure it's lightweight but can also withstand the harsh racing conditions that it may encounter. The aesthetics of the racing yacht are just as impressive as its performance, with an all-black design and the iconic Hugo Boss logo written along the sail.

The yacht also features a distinct honeycomb pattern by renowned industrial designer Konstanin Grcic. This is the second yacht made by the Alex Thompson racing team, but the IMOCA is custom-made for racer Alex Thompson himself. Thompson contributed to the all-black modern design as well as the increased ergonomic capabilities of the racing yacht.Photo Credits: yachtsandyachting, designboom
